2. Ingredients for the Creamy Butter Chicken Skillet
- 1.5 lbs boneless, skinless chicken breasts or thighs, cut into bite-sized pieces
- 2 tablespoons butter
- 1 medium onion, diced
- 3 cloves garlic, minced
- 1 cup tomato sauce or crushed tomatoes
- 1/2 cup heavy cream or coconut milk for a dairy-free option
- 2 teaspoons paprika
- 1 teaspoon cumin
- Salt and freshly ground black pepper to taste
- Fresh parsley or cilantro for garnish
3. Step-by-Step Instructions for Making the Creamy Butter Chicken Skillet
Prep the Chicken
Start by seasoning your chicken pieces with a pinch of salt, pepper, paprika, and cumin. Sauté them in a large skillet over medium-high heat with 1 tablespoon of butter until browned and cooked through. Remove and set aside.
Sauté Aromatics
In the same skillet, melt the remaining tablespoon of butter. Add diced onions and cook until translucent, then stir in minced garlic and cook until fragrant—about 30 seconds.
Create the Sauce
Pour in tomato sauce or crushed tomatoes, stirring to combine. Let it simmer for 5 minutes to deepen the flavors. Then, slowly stir in heavy cream or coconut milk for a rich, creamy texture.
Combine Chicken and Serve
Return the cooked chicken to the skillet, tossing to coat evenly in the sauce. Allow everything to simmer together for an additional 5 minutes. Garnish with freshly chopped parsley or cilantro before serving.
4. Storage Tips for Leftover Creamy Chicken Skillet
Store any leftovers in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3 days. To reheat, gently warm in a skillet over low heat, stirring occasionally to restore creaminess. For longer storage, you can freeze it for up to 2 months.

6. Frequently Asked Questions about the Butter Chicken Skillet
Can I make this recipe healthier?
Absolutely! Substitute heavy cream with light coconut milk or Greek yogurt for a lower-fat version. Using skinless chicken breasts can also reduce fat content.
What are some easy substitutions?
If you don’t have tomato sauce, canned diced tomatoes work well. For dairy-free diets, coconut milk makes a creamy, delicious alternative.
How long does it take to prepare?
Preparation and cooking combined take about 30 minutes, making this easy butter chicken ideal for busy weeknights.

Creamy Texas Roadhouse Butter Chicken Skillet Delight
A luscious butter chicken skillet featuring tender chicken cooked in a creamy, spiced sauce, perfect for a quick and satisfying meal.
- Total Time: 30 minutes
- Yield: 4 servings
Ingredients
- 1 lb boneless skinless chicken breasts, cut into bite-sized pieces
- 2 tbsp butter
- 3 cloves garlic, minced
- 1 small onion, chopped
- 1 cup heavy cream
- 1 tablespoon tomato paste
- 1 teaspoon paprika
- 1 teaspoon garam masala
- Salt and pepper to taste
- Fresh parsley, chopped (for garnish)
Instructions
- Heat butter in a large skillet over medium heat. Add chicken pieces and cook until browned and cooked through. Remove and set aside.
- In the same skillet, sauté onion and garlic until fragrant and translucent.
- Stir in tomato paste, paprika, garam masala, salt, and pepper. Cook for 1 minute to toast spices.
- Pour in heavy cream, stirring to combine. Bring to a gentle simmer and cook until sauce thickens slightly.
- Add cooked chicken back to the skillet and stir to coat with the sauce. Heat through for a few minutes.
- Garnish with chopped parsley and serve hot with rice or bread.
Notes
- You can add a dash of cayenne pepper for extra heat.
- For a healthier option, substitute heavy cream with coconut milk.
